Output fd171eb6025475c03ca0d08b7fca59bb3857b80a92a845267c073a5ed9b3086c:1

value
6969111817576
script pubkey
OP_0 OP_PUSHBYTES_20 e05b0916e970e49b51404bf7aff21298597f60ea
address
tb1qupdsj9hfwrjfk52qf0m6lusjnpvh7c82dhz024
transaction
fd171eb6025475c03ca0d08b7fca59bb3857b80a92a845267c073a5ed9b3086c
confirmations
194098
spent
true